New Orleans police searching for $930 boat store theft suspect

NEW ORLEANS (WGNO) — The New Orleans Police Department is hoping to identify and arrest a suspect who is accused of stealing $930 in merchandise from a West Marine in Lakeview. The case is the latest one to roll on the Wheel of Justice.

According to police, the theft happened on Friday, Oct. 3, at the West Marine in the 800 block of Harrison Avenue. Police also released security camera footage of the suspect.

In the video, the suspect is seen walking with a purse while holding at least one of the store’s items in her hands. Police say the woman allegedly hid $930 worth of items inside her purse and walked out the door without paying. They did not release specific information on what items were allegedly taken.
